titleOfInvention | Process for the preparation of hydrazine hydrate |
abstract | The present invention relates to a process for the preparation of hydrazine hydrate in which methyl ethyl ketone azine is hydrolysed in order to obtain hydrazine hydrate and methyl ethyl ketone, characterized in that heterocycles of the pyrazoline family are bled off in an amount sufficient to prevent coloration of the hydrazine hydrate. |
